Wide-angle lens The invention relates to a wide-angle lens with large focal length on the image side according to patent ... (patent application P 17 72 665.7).

(patent application P 17 72 665.7) are tripartite Lenses described whose first and last link have a negative refractive power and the middle link of which has a positive refractive power. The aperture is between the second and third link arranged.

Das vor der Blende stehende Glied mit negativer Brechkraft weist vorteilhaft ausschließlich zur Blende hohle Flächen auf, seine Brechkraft ist, absolut genommen, großer als die Gesamtbrennweite des Objektivs. Die unmittelbar auf die Blende folgende Fläche des hinter der Blende stehenden Gliedes mit negativer Brechkraft und die letzte bildseitige Fläche sollen bevorzugt zur Blende hin hohl sein, ihre Krümmungsradien sollen kleiner sein als die Gesamtbrennweite des Objektivs.The element with negative refractive power standing in front of the diaphragm has advantageous exclusively for the aperture, its refractive power is, taken in absolute terms, larger than the total focal length of the lens. The one immediately following the aperture Area of the member standing behind the diaphragm with negative refractive power and the The last surface on the image side should preferably be hollow towards the diaphragm, their radii of curvature should be smaller than the total focal length of the lens.

Sie sind daher sehr gut für Spiegelreflexkameras oder für Kameras, bei denen zwischen Objektiv und Bildfenster ein (ausschwenkbares) lichtempfindliches Element angeordnet ist, geeignet.Lenses with this general structure are particularly cheap as To use wide-angle lenses that have a large focal length on the image side. They are therefore very good for SLR cameras or for cameras with those between Lens and image window a (pivotable) light-sensitive element arranged is suitable.
